Table 1. Demographic and clinical characteristics of the study population.

Variables Unmatched groups Matched groups
PCNB group (n = 113) SB group (n = 245) P value PCNB group (n = 58) SB group (n = 58) P value
Age, yr 65.6 ± 10.0 62.9 ± 10.1 0.019 64.7 ± 10.3 65.0 ± 8.7 0.833
Sex, male 46 (40.7) 96 (39.2) 0.784 19 (32.8) 18 (31.0) 0.827
Smoking 0.974 0.722
Never 77 (68.1) 168 (68.6) 43 (74.1) 45 (77.6)
Ex 28 (24.8) 60 (24.5) 13 (22.4) 10 (17.2)
Current 8 (7.1) 15 (6.1) 2 (3.5) 3 (5.2)
FEV1, % 106.8 ± 17.6 108.2 ± 16.9 0.485 107.0 ± 19.1 108.3 ± 14.9 0.685
DLCO, % 92.0 ± 16.2 94.8 ± 17.7 0.153 91.4 ± 15.3 93.7 ± 15.3 0.546
Size of tumor, mm 20.0 ± 6.0 17.2 ± 6.3 < 0.001 17.9 ± 5.9 17.4 ± 6.4 0.580
C/T ratio 0.95 ± 0.13 0.60 ± 0.33 < 0.001 0.90 ± 0.17 0.89 ± 0.18 0.621
Clinical T stage < 0.001 0.706
cT1 93 (82.3) 230 (93.9) 52 (89.7) 53 (91.4)
cT2 18 (15.9) 15 (6.1) 6 (10.3) 5 (8.6)
cT3 2 (1.8) 0 0 0
Clinical N stage NA NA
cN0 113 (100.0) 245 (100.0) 58 (100.0) 58 (100.0)

Data are presented as mean ± standard deviation or number (%).

PCNB = percutaneous needle biopsy, SB = surgical biopsy, FEV1 = forced expiratory volume in one second, DLCO = diffusing capacity of carbon monoxide, C/T ratio = consolidation/tumor ratio.
